The Society for New Communications Research (SNCR) announces the application process for its Fellowships. The Society for New Communications Research Fellowship is a year-long, volunteer-based programme. All futurists, scholars, technologists, business leaders, professional communicators, and members of the media from around the globe are invited to apply. A maximum of 12 Fellows will be accepted for these one-year (renewable) volunteer-based fellowships.
